At 1YA.

oevT eHEeEpew TUESDAY, DECEMBER. 17: A new , set of performers to entertain us this evening. Miss Sale is bringing her pupils to assist Uncle George with songs, piano solos and duets. WEDNESDAY: Here’s Uncle Tom with his usual store of jokes and stories, and cousins with sketches and recitations. THURSDAY: Peter Pan with us for the last time before his holidays. More piano duets and recitations from cousins. FRIDAY: What do you think Nod and Aunt Jean have for the Happy. Family this evening? A Christmas play entitled ‘"‘The Old Toys." Now doesn’t that sound jolly? SATURDAY: Good news this evening. Ariel back again, so there will. be some Christmas music and oldtime music to tune in to. Of course Cinderella will also be present with stories and birthday greetings. SUNDAY: Children’s Song Service conducted by Uncle Leo, assisted by Howe Street Brethren Sunday School.
